Lenna by a Summer House, c. 1917 (oil on canvas)
650739 Lenna by a Summer House, c.1917 (oil on canvas) by Glackens, William James (1870-1938); 46x61.5 cm; Private Collection; (add.info.: Lenna by a Summer House. William James Glackens (1870-1938). Oil on canvas. Painted c. 1917. 46 x 61.5 cm. A study of the artists daughter, aged 5, in the garden of his Wifes parents home in West Hartford, Connecticut.); Photo eChristies Images; American, out of copyright

Lenna by a Summer House, c. 1917
EDITORS COMMENTS
is a captivating oil painting by American artist William James Glackens. The artwork, measuring 46x61.5 cm, portrays the artist's daughter Lenna at the tender age of five in the serene garden of his wife's parents' home in West Hartford, Connecticut. The scene exudes an idyllic charm with its lush greenery and warm sunlight filtering through the trees. Lenna stands as a young model for her father, capturing her youthful innocence and natural beauty on canvas. Glackens was part of the Ashcan School movement and his work often depicted scenes from everyday life in early twentieth-century America. In this particular piece, he skillfully captures both the essence of childhood and the tranquility of summertime. The painting showcases Glackens' mastery in portraying light and color through his brushstrokes, creating a picturesque representation that transports viewers to this peaceful moment in time.
